Overview

This talk explores how active travel can be designed and engineered into everyday urban life to create safer streets and stronger communities. It will discuss how infrastructure that supports walking, cycling, and micromobility can lead to healthier, more connected, and resilient cities. Active travel is more than a transport choice, it is a catalyst for improving public health, reducing carbon emissions, and revitalising public spaces. By rethinking how streets are planned and used, engineers and planners can help shift mobility habits and create environments where people feel safe and encouraged to move actively.

Participants will gain insights into the role of civil engineering in reshaping urban environments, with a focus on integrating safety, accessibility, and sustainability into transport networks. The format will include a presentation followed by a Q&A session to encourage discussion and knowledge sharing among attendees.

Linza Wells

With over 28 years of experience in the transportation sector, Ms. Linza Wells obtained her BA (Hons) from the University of Liverpool and her MSc from the University of London, England. She has been an alumna member of the International Association of Traffic and Safety Science (IATSS) Forum Japan since 2004.

Ms. Wells was previously a Chartered Member of the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port and is now a Chartered Member of the Chartered Institute of Highways and Transportation and the Transport Planning Society.

Throughout her career in the transportation sector, she has been involved in numerous consultancy projects across Southeast Asia, Africa, the Middle East, and the UK as a consultant and project manager.

She is currently overseeing both MDS Consultancy Group and Traffic Planners & Consultants.
